  • How has the paint held up? I'll be getting a MBP shortly, but wish it would be black.

  • @Daghead I actually took it off with a little organic spray paint remover. But while it was on it was fine, the key to this is a layer of clear coat to really seal the deal! good luck with yours

  • @Daghead Pretty well as long as you are patient and take your time. What I dis was two or three coats of paint the a clear enamel the lock it in. However I did remove the all of the paint from mine and will be coming up with a new design and paint scheme in the future. By the way, make sure you use pain that works with metal, and if you do decide to remove the paint as I did, there are organic "spray paint removers" that will remove the paint and will cause no harm to your computer.
